    Flyers' Tyson Foerster: Two points including GWG

    Tyson Foerster scored the game-winning goal and added a power-play assist in Saturday's 3-2 win over the Bruins.After helping to set up Travis Konecny for the afternoon's first goal late in the second period, Foerster snapped a shot past Linus Ullmark with only 89 seconds left in the third. The 22-year-old Foerster had managed only one point, a goal, over the prior eight games. He has 18 goals and 31 points through 66 games in his first full NHL season.

    Flyers' Tyson Foerster: Nine goals in last nine games

    Tyson Foerster scored twice Saturday in a 4-2 win over Ottawa.Both goals came in the final minute of the second period. Foerster put the Philadelphia Flyers up 2-1 at 19:13 when he jumped on a loose puck off a face-off and wired a wrist shot past Mads Sogaard from above the left circle. He then scored five-hole on a penalty shot at 19:58 to push the score to 3-1; the goal stood as the winner. Foerster has been a goal machine lately, putting up nine markers (ten points) on 24 shots in his last nine games. He's now tied with Dmitri Voronkov for third among rookies in goals with 16.

    Flyers' Tyson Foerster: Three-point effort in loss

    Tyson Foerster scored two goals, one on the power play, and added an even-strength assist in Sunday's 7-6 loss to the Penguins.After tying the game at 2-2 early in the second period, Foerster potted his second tally with just over three minutes left in the third to bring the Philadelphia Flyers within a goal, but the team couldn't find an equalizer before the final buzzer. It's Foerster's second two-goal performance in his last six games and his first three-point effort of the season. The 22-year-old rookie is up to 13 goals and 25 points through 54 contests on the season.
